Daredevil05 here is your cover. THis one was a tough one. To get to the final print I had to go through 10 yes 10 needles to make this one right. This is a tough design to do. I digitized this one twice and tried stitching at other angels to make sure it would be nice. The final was done using an imported needle that is the smallest that you can put in a sewing machine. The slightest off center puncture from the needle will cause it to break and or any tention from pulling on the string over the rated tention. There for 10 needles pooped. 4 on the final print alone. I did 6 test prints at diffrent tention, speeds, and stablizer thickness to get here. I go this far as I dont want nothing but the best in quality to go out to the customer. My needles are imported from Germany and I think that it is worth it as they always provide the best quality. The Thread that I use for the Boots that I make come from there as well. So now here you go. There is 15,000 stitches in this one. Daredevil please post so I can leave you feedback. This photo is not taken dead on or the flash blinds out the cover.
